Key takeaway

India's Coal Ministry launches the 16th round of commercial coal mine auctions, offering 25 blocks across eight states.

  1. Step 1 · The triggerThe Coal Ministry auctions 25 new coal blocks, expanding the pool of commercially mineable assets.
  2. Step 2 · Knock-onNew and existing coal companies invest to develop these blocks, increasing domestic coal supply and competition.
  3. Step 3 · Reaches youGreater coal availability moderates input costs for Indian SMEs reliant on coal, improving cost visibility and potentially supporting employment in mining regions.
